文章目录

  • rasa nlp 组件
  • Spacy安装说明
  • rasa配置
  • spacy实体抽取

rasa nlp 组件

Rasa官方提供了多种Language Models的组件引入,包括:

  • MitieNLP
  • SpacyNLP
  • HFTransformersNLP

组件说明见,地址:https://rasa.com/docs/rasa/components

Spacy安装说明

Spacy提供的安装说明,如下:

pip install -U pip setuptools wheel
pip install -U spacy
python -m spacy download en_core_web_sm

详见官网地址:https://spacy.io/usage#quickstart

下载模型将出现错误,可通过域名反查ip地址,把ip地址写入hosts解决。

域名反查ip地址:https://www.ipaddress.com/

实际上,模型从github地址下载:https://github.com/explosion/spacy-models/tags

所以可以还可以通过以下方式安装:

# With external URL
$ pip install https://github.com/explosion/spacy-models/releases/download/en_core_web_sm-3.0.0/en_core_web_sm-3.0.0-py3-none-any.whl
$ pip install https://github.com/explosion/spacy-models/releases/download/en_core_web_sm-3.0.0/en_core_web_sm-3.0.0.tar.gz# With local file
$ pip install /Users/you/en_core_web_sm-3.0.0-py3-none-any.whl
$ pip install /Users/you/en_core_web_sm-3.0.0.tar.gz

rasa配置

rasa官方配置说明:https://rasa.com/docs/rasa/tuning-your-model#sensible-starting-pipelines

我的配置示例:

language: "zh"pipeline:- name: SpacyNLPmodel: "zh_core_web_sm"case_sensitive: TRUEintent_tokenization_flag: Trueintent_split_symbol: "_"- name: SpacyTokenizer- name: SpacyFeaturizer- name: RegexFeaturizer- name: LexicalSyntacticFeaturizer- name: CountVectorsFeaturizer- name: CountVectorsFeaturizeranalyzer: "char_wb"min_ngram: 1max_ngram: 4- name: DIETClassifierepochs: 100- name: EntitySynonymMapper- name: ResponseSelectorepochs: 100policies:- name: MemoizationPolicy- name: TEDPolicymax_history: 5epochs: 100- name: RulePolicy

spacy实体抽取

rasa官网描述:spacyentityextractor

抽取维度见网址:https://explosion.ai/demos/displacy-ent

我的实体抽取示例:

language: "zh"pipeline:- name: SpacyNLPmodel: "zh_core_web_sm"case_sensitive: TRUEintent_tokenization_flag: Trueintent_split_symbol: "_"- name: "SpacyEntityExtractor"dimensions: ["PERSON", "LOC", "ORG", "PRODUCT", "DATE", "TIME", "GPE"]- name: SpacyTokenizer- name: SpacyFeaturizer- name: RegexFeaturizer- name: LexicalSyntacticFeaturizer- name: CountVectorsFeaturizer- name: CountVectorsFeaturizeranalyzer: "char_wb"min_ngram: 1max_ngram: 4- name: DIETClassifierepochs: 100- name: EntitySynonymMapper- name: ResponseSelectorepochs: 100policies:- name: MemoizationPolicy- name: TEDPolicymax_history: 5epochs: 100- name: RulePolicy

rasa安装spaCy相关推荐

  1. 2.4.安装spaCy

    2.4.安装spaCy 进入Anaconda的prompt命令行界面,执行如下: (base) C:\Users\toto>pip install spaCy -i https://pypi.t ...

  2. python spacy 安装超时_安装spacy失败

    我有个问题. 我试图在我的linux机器上安装spacy,但是这个命令给了我很多错误:pip3 install spacy 这是我尝试安装时得到的输出: ^{pr2}$ 所有的输出都是相关的. 我不知 ...

  3. 安装spacy遇到的问题

    在Windows 10 和 Ubuntu 16.04 环境下安装 spacy ,运行的命令是 pip install spacy, 在安装的过程中都遇到了这个问题,报错信息如下: Cannot uni ...

  4. 安装spacy库出现错误OSError: [E050] Can‘t find model ‘en‘.以及安装成功了但是有些功能无法使用等问题

    在python运行环境中运行如下代码 import spacy nlp = spacy.load('en') 出现如下错误:OSError: [E050] Can't find model 'en'. ...

  5. python如何下载安装spacy_使用pip安装Spacy时出错

    它可能与虚拟环境(venv)中安装的其他python包发生冲突.我就是这样.我尝试将pip安装到已经安装了以下软件包的venv中:appnope==0.1.0 beautifulsoup4==4.5. ...

  6. 安装SpaCy及en模型

    1.下载SpaCy, SpaCy官网 conda install -c conda-forge spacy 查看是否安装成功,及Spacy版本 conda env list 2.下载en模型 2.1 ...

  7. RASA NLU Chi安装

    1 RASA NLU简介... 2 2 准备... 2 2.1 环境说明... 2 3 安装... 4 3.1 下载软件... 4 3.2 安装... 4 3.4 安装问题... 5 4 使用... ...

  8. spacy中en_core_web_sm安装问题

    spacy中en_core_web_sm安装问题 1.安装spacy pip install spacy 2.安装en_core_web_sm conda install -c conda-forge ...

  9. spacy语言模型安装踩坑经历

    萌新只是想做一个chatbot,文本分析时安装spacy时踩了两个小时的坑.终于找到了行之有效的方法. 相信如果按照官方的安装方法安装好了,并且运行没有报错,你就不会来看这篇博客了吧=_=. 我就直接 ...

最新文章

  1. STL中的nth_element()方法的使用
  2. IBM 340 亿美元收购 RedHat(红帽)
  3. Keras方法进行词嵌入
  4. what should you do if you want to have a high efficiency for communication
  5. 正则表达式,grep,sed,
  6. 计算机导航 骨科 ppt模板,(医学PPT课件)术中即时三维导航在脊柱侧弯矫形的应用...
  7. Internationalization(i18n) support in SAP CRM,UI5 and Hybris
  8. 串口速度,RS232与MAX232的区别
  9. 23种经典设计模式UML类图汇总
  10. 【干货】最新app源码下载:200款优秀Android项目源码
  11. 基于bim二次开发的智能楼宇管理系统
  12. html embed页面无法播放视频,embed标签什么意思 手机无法播放网页上embed标签的视频...
  13. 卧槽!全网最全编程学习网站汇总!还不赶快放到收藏夹里吃灰~
  14. 超声波传感器(CHx01) 学习笔记 Ⅲ-API介绍
  15. mysql硬盘最长活动时间100%_win10磁盘活动时间100%,小编告诉你解决方法
  16. 云视频会议已成未来发展必然趋势
  17. C#查询自己的公网IP接口(有服务器)
  18. 明朝首辅/太师,辅佐明朝四代国之重臣杨士奇后世传人在松滋
  19. csm和uefi_[整理]BIOS设置UEFI和安全引导
  20. 字符串(一) | 剑指 Offer 58 - II. 左旋转字符串、541. 反转字符串 II、剑指 Offer 05. 替换空格、151. 反转字符串中的单词

热门文章

  1. 清华大学计算机系1979,清华大学1979级毕业30周年纪念大会召开
  2. 历时半年,Web版Skype扩大测试范围至美国和英国所有用户
  3. 大数据下的2018国庆旅游6k景点分析
  4. 遂川天气预报软件测试,遂川天气预报15天
  5. 【洛谷】 P5716 月份天数
  6. 离服务器很近就是没有wifi信号为什么,卧室没有wifi信号怎么办
  7. E.03.19A Village Erased
  8. python里的set的discard和remove的区别
  9. 实现Springboot整合uflo2
  10. 甲骨文发布第三季度财报 云业务拉动营收增长